EVER OHMS Resistor Selection Guide
I. Brand Overview
EVER OHMS TECHNOLOGY CO., LTD., established in 1988 and headquartered in Kaohsiung, Taiwan, is a professional manufacturer specializing in the R&D and production of chip resistors and resistor networks. The company holds ISO9001 and IATF16949 certifications, with multiple core products meeting AEC-Q200 automotive-grade standards. EVER OHMS product portfolio covers thick film resistors, thin film precision resistors, alloy resistors, anti-sulfur resistors, automotive-grade resistors, and more, widely used in automotive electronics, industrial control, communications equipment, new energy, and consumer electronics.
II. Part Number Decoding
EVER OHMS employs a standardized part number naming convention. Taking CRH2512F33R0E04Z as an example:
| Field | Meaning |
|---|---|
| CRH | Series code (High Power Thick Film Chip Resistor) |
| 2512 | EIA package size (6.35mm × 3.20mm) |
| F | Tolerance grade (F=±1%, J=±5%, B=±0.1%) |
| 33R0 | Nominal resistance (R denotes decimal point, 33R0=33Ω) |
| E04 | TCR/Packaging code |
| Z | Reel suffix (Lead-free, RoHS compliant) |
Understanding the part number coding is the first step in selection, enabling quick identification of series, package, tolerance, and resistance value.
III. Key Selection Parameters
1. Resistance
EVER OHMS resistors cover an extremely wide range, from ultra-low resistance (0.3mΩ) to high resistance (30MΩ). Selection should be based on the circuit design target value, with attention to the distinction between nominal and actual operating resistance.
2. Tolerance
Tolerance directly affects circuit output accuracy. EVER OHMS offers multiple tolerance grades:
-
±0.01% ~ ±0.1%: Thin film precision resistors, suitable for medical instruments and precision measurement
-
±0.5% ~ ±1%: General precision grade, suitable for most industrial control and power management applications
-
±5%: General grade, suitable for consumer electronics with less stringent accuracy requirements
3. Power Rating
Power selection must consider actual power dissipation with adequate margin. EVER OHMS resistors cover from milliwatts to several watts:
-
Small packages (0402/0603): 0.063W ~ 0.1W
-
Medium packages (0805/1206): 0.125W ~ 0.5W
-
Large packages (2010/2512): 0.5W ~ 4W
Power derating is a critical consideration. Actual operating power should not exceed 70% of rated power, with further derating required in high-temperature environments.
4. Temperature Coefficient (TCR)
TCR determines resistance stability with temperature variation. EVER OHMS TCR options include:
-
±10ppm/℃: Highest precision grade, for precision instruments
-
±50ppm/℃: Standard for metal film series
-
±100ppm/℃: Mainstream for thick film series
-
±150ppm/℃ ~ ±400ppm/℃: High-power or special applications
For temperature-sensitive applications such as current sensing and precision voltage division, low TCR products should be prioritized.
5. Package Size
Package determines PCB footprint and heat dissipation capability. EVER OHMS covers the full range from 0402 to 2512 and larger. Larger packages offer higher power handling but occupy more PCB area. Selection requires balancing power requirements against space constraints.
6. Operating Temperature Range
EVER OHMS resistors typically operate from -55℃ to +155℃ . Automotive-grade products with AEC-Q200 certification maintain stable performance under high temperature, vibration, and other harsh conditions.
IV. Major Series Comparison and Selection Recommendations
Thick Film Resistor Series
| Series | Power (2512) | TCR | Features | Applications |
|---|---|---|---|---|
| CRH | 2W | ±100ppm/℃ | High cost-performance, high power density | Power modules, industrial control, consumer electronics |
| CUH | 3W | ±150ppm/℃ | Ultra-high power, 50% higher than CRH | High-density power supplies, 5G base stations, automotive ECUs |
| CHH | 4W | ±100~±400ppm/℃ | Highest power thick film | Extreme power requirements |
Recommendation: Choose CRH for general power needs (best cost-performance); choose CUH when power approaches 2.5W and a larger package is not feasible; choose CHH for 4W requirements.
Metal Film Resistor Series
| Series | Power (2512) | TCR | Features | Applications |
|---|---|---|---|---|
| TRL | 2W/3W | ±50ppm/℃ | Low TCR, high precision | Precision measurement, communications, medical electronics |
| TGL | 2W/3.5W | ±50ppm/℃ | Anti-surge, high reliability | Automotive electronics, communication base stations, LED drivers |
Recommendation: Choose TRL for low TCR and high precision requirements; choose TGL for surge-prone or harsh environments.
Alloy Resistor Series
EVER OHMS alloy resistors are core products for current sensing applications, including:
-
MA Series: 0.3mΩ~0.45Ω, 0.5W~7W
-
MR Series: 1mΩ~50mΩ, high cost-performance
-
MRE Series: Small footprint (0201~1206), suitable for compact devices
-
Four-terminal current sense resistors (ERS/ERL/ERM): Eliminate lead resistance effects for high-precision current sensing
Automotive-Grade Resistor Series
QR Series and TQ Series are AEC-Q200 certified, meeting stringent automotive electronics requirements. Tolerance ranges from ±0.05% to ±1%, with TCR as low as ±10ppm/℃.
Anti-Sulfur Resistor Series
ST Series and TSL Series are designed for sulfur-laden environments, passing ASTM B-809 sulfur testing, suitable for mines, power plants, wastewater treatment, and other harsh industrial settings.
V. Application-Based Selection Quick Reference
| Application | Recommended Series | Key Considerations |
|---|---|---|
| Switching Power Supplies/DC-DC | CRH, CUH | Power, surge handling |
| Current Sensing | MA, MR, ERS | Low resistance, high accuracy, low TCR |
| Automotive Electronics/BMS | QR, TQ, TGL | AEC-Q200 certification |
| Precision Instruments | TR, TRL | High accuracy, low TCR |
| Industrial Control | CRH, ST | Power, anti-sulfur |
| LED Drivers | CRH, TGL | Power, anti-surge |
| 5G Communications/Base Stations | CUH, TGL | High power, stability |
